引言
随着区块链技术的迅猛发展和虚拟货币的普及,越来越多的人开始关注如何安全地存储和管理自己的数字资产。虚拟币钱包便是这一存储方式中的关键要素。尤其是钱包地址的生成规律,理解这一点对于用户在进行交易和保护资产安全至关重要。本文将对此进行深入探讨,并解答相关的常见问题。
虚拟币钱包的基本概念
虚拟币钱包是用于存储虚拟货币(如比特币、以太坊等)的软件或硬件工具,其主要功能是管理用户的私钥和公钥。钱包地址是用户在区块链网络中用以接收转账的“账号”,其通常是公钥的哈希值的某种形式。了解钱包地址的增长规律,可以帮助用户更好地风险管理和保护资产。
虚拟币钱包地址的生成过程
虚拟币钱包地址的生成过程相对复杂,涉及多个步骤和加密技术。以比特币为例,生成地址的过程如下:
- 生成私钥:私钥是一个随机生成的256位数字,其至关重要,因为拥有私钥即拥有相应的虚拟币。私钥通常由用户的计算机使用高强度随机数生成器生成。
- 生成公钥:通过椭圆曲线算法(ECDSA)将私钥转换为公钥。公钥可以公开,然而私钥必须严格保密。
- 地址哈希:公钥通过多次哈希加密处理(如SHA-256和RIPEMD-160),最终生成一个独特的地址,这就是用户在进行交易时所使用的钱包地址。
这个流程不仅确保了地址的唯一性与安全性,还恰当地保护了用户的隐私。
钱包地址的格式与类型
虚拟币钱包地址的格式和类型多种多样,以比特币为例,可以分为以下几种:
- P2PKH地址:以“1”开头,这种地址格式是比特币最早的地址格式,通常用于简单的交易。
- P2SH地址:以“3”开头,支持多重签名等高级功能。
- Bech32地址:以“bc1”开头,为比特币的闪电网络和SegWit(隔离见证)交易设计的地址格式。
虚拟币钱包地址的生成规律
根据生成方式和步骤,虚拟币钱包地址的生成规律有以下几点:
- 随机性:每个钱包地址的生成都依据一个独特的私钥,这使其具有极高的随机性和唯一性。
- 可再生性:使用同一私钥再次生成公钥和地址时,可以再次得到相同的结果,确保了可再生性。
- 哈希性质:经过哈希处理后的结果无法从原始数据中提取,这使得地址的生成和使用更加安全。
与钱包地址生成相关的问题
问题 1: 如何安全地生成虚拟币钱包地址?
生成虚拟币钱包地址的安全性与私钥的安全性密切相关。首先,应选择信誉较高的加密货币钱包软件或硬件。其次,使用本地生成私钥的方式,不通过网络生成,这样可以有效避免网络攻击风险。最后,务必将私钥存储在安全的地方,可以考虑使用冷钱包进行离线存储,提高安全性。
问题 2: 虚拟币钱包地址会过期吗?
虚拟币钱包地址一般不会过期。一旦生成,该地址可以长期使用,直到用户选择销毁或不再使用该地址为止。然而,用户应定期检查钱包余额和使用情况,确保其地址依旧安全有效。
问题 3: 用同一钱包地址接收多次转账安全吗?
使用同一钱包地址进行多次接收交易并不安全,因为每次接收到的交易都将关联到同一地址,会暴露用户的匿名性。因此,很多安全建议建议用户每次交易时生成新的地址,以增强隐私保护。
问题 4: 钱包地址被曝光会有什么风险?
如果钱包地址被曝光,特别是与用户身份相关联,则可能面临资产被监控和潜在的盗窃风险。因此,保护钱包地址的隐私十分重要,使用多个地址和定期更换地址可以降低风险。
问题 5: 钱包地址的重复使用对财务记录有什么影响?
重复使用同一钱包地址可能会导致财务记录难以追踪,因为所有交易都会集中在一个地址上,付款人和收款人的隐私信息会被其他人观察到。为了保持财务记录的整洁,应尽量使用不同的钱包地址进行不同的交易。
总结
虚拟币钱包地址的生成是一个复杂却至关重要的过程,理解这一过程有助于用户更加安全地管理数字资产。希望本文能够帮助用户更深入地了解虚拟币钱包地址的生成规律及相关的重要知识。